Wayne Pascoe wrote: > > Hi there, > > I am trying to break into contributing to FreeBSD. I've been reading > through the PR database, but the one thing that I do not see is the > closed PR's. > > The reason I want to see these is to see some sample problems, and how > they were closed. Being able to see the patch, etc. would also be > great. > > So in short, where can I find the closed PR's ? > I assume you are at http://www.FreeBSD.org/cgi/query-pr-summary.cgi , right. In the last paragraph before all the PRs this is a link to "Include closed reports too" Jim -- /"\ ASCII Ribbon Campaign . \ / - NO HTML/RTF in e-mail .
